Regards, Ashish Mathur www.ashishmathur.com WebOct 25, 2024 · The way to compute percentage change is (new - old) / old. So, if Apr sales were 20 and May were 0, then you would get (0-20)/20 = -1, i.e., -100%. Of course, if the old were zero, then the result is undefined (or infinite depending on your preference). You can use an IF statement to check the referenced cell (s) and return one result for zero or blank, and otherwise return your formula result. A simple example: =IF (B1=0;"";A1/B1) This would return an empty string if the divisor B1 is blank or zero; otherwise it returns the result of dividing A1 by B1.
